It is natural for individuals to think about how to have a successful law career. Truthfully, one of the most essential tips for becoming a lawyer is to have some legal work experience on your CV. Getting some real-life experience at a law firm will offer you a very useful opportunity to network with industry specialists, discover several of the essential hard and soft skill-sets and eventually, determine whether the fast-paced nature of the role is suitable for you. This is exactly why it is very important to demonstrate dedication and effort by arranging some informal work experience at a legal practice whilst completing your studies, like by doing some voluntary roles or a summer internship. This might involve spending a number of weeks shadowing a lawyer or carrying out general administrative responsibilities around the workplace. Even if you are working at a law firm which specialises in a kind of law which you are not interested in, these placements are still very useful learning experiences and will make your application stand out from the various other applicants, as people like Louise Flanagan in Ras Al Khaimah would definitely confirm.

In terms of how to start a law career, the first thing to do is to get the right credentials. Sadly, even the entry-level positions in law firms commonly tend to favor candidates to have an undergraduate degree under their belt, specifically since it is such a competitive industry. As a result, you want to ensure that you have actually carried out the correct research and know exactly what academic pathway you need to take in order to acquire the desired qualifications. Besides, there are many different types of law career around, which means that not all the certifications are the exact same. For instance, having a standard bachelor's degree is an excellent place to start off, yet you will certainly need to proceed onto further certifications depending on what sort of law profession you have an interest in. If you are intending to become a solicitor, there is a particular lawyer's assessment that you will certainly need to finish in order to become qualified, much like exactly how you will need to do a different certification if you have dreams of becoming a barrister.
When finding out how to become a lawyer, it here is crucial to comprehend specifically what kind of difficult and soft skills for lawyers are called for. No matter what sort of law profession you go into, specific skills are transferable and widespread across the different legal divisions. A prime example of this is having reliable verbal and written communication, as individuals like Racha Lucero in Dubai would agree. As a lawyer, effective communication is an ability which will certainly be utilized every single day of your occupation, whether its organising a meeting with a client to review the case or drafting up precise reports. In addition, being able to get your point across and convey relevant information in a way which is clear and straightforward is a quality that will be especially essential in court setups.
